AG Hickman, age 94, passed away on March 28, 2023 at Accura Healthcare of Pleasantville, Iowa. AG was born on November 20, 1928 to Virgil and Genevieve (Wheeler) Hickman. He married Oleta Poore in October 1952. To this union four children were born, Dan, Christine, David and Charles. AG owned the DX gas station located on Main Street in Chariton before selling it and going to work for Hy-Vee as a mechanic in the truck shop. He enjoyed his many years working at Hy-Vee. When AG retired, he and Oleta moved to Apache Junction, Arizona. They looked forward to coming back to Iowa in the summer for visits with family and friends. They also enjoyed going to Decorah, Iowa where they camped and went trout fishing for many years.
After Oleta passed away in 2000, AG met and married Frances Brown. They continued to live in Apache Junction, Arizona during the winter and Nortonville, Kansas in the summer. They shared several happy years together traveling to both Alaska and Hawaii.
When Frances passed away in 2017, AG continued living in Nortonville, Kansas until he was unable to live alone any longer. He moved to Homestead assisted-living in Chariton. He enjoyed his time living there and kept the residents entertained with his sense of humor.
Eventually he needed more support and moved to Accura Healthcare of Pleasantville, where he received loving care until peacefully passing away.
AG was preceded in death by his parents Virgil Hickman and Genevieve Hickman, wife Oleta (Poore) Hickman, son David Hickman, son Charles Hickman, sister Dora Mae Medearis and wife Frances (Brown) Hickman.
Left to cherish his memory are his son Dan (Beverly) Hickman, daughter Christine (Mickey) Etter and sister Mary Lou (Richard) Mitchell as well as many gr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ces, nephews and extended family and friends.
